首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

提交对数据库的更改

数据库的更改是指对数据库中存储的数据进行修改、添加或删除的操作。数据库是用于存储和管理数据的系统,它可以提供数据的持久化存储、高效的数据访问和管理功能。

数据库的更改可以通过以下几种方式进行:

  1. 数据库的修改:数据库的修改包括对数据库结构的更改,例如添加、修改或删除表、字段、索引等。这些修改可以通过使用数据库管理系统(DBMS)提供的管理工具或SQL语句来实现。数据库的修改通常需要谨慎操作,因为不当的修改可能会导致数据丢失或数据不一致。
  2. 数据的插入:数据的插入是指向数据库中添加新的数据记录。插入操作可以通过使用INSERT语句来实现,将新的数据值插入到指定的表中。插入操作常用于向数据库中添加新的用户、订单、文章等数据。
  3. 数据的更新:数据的更新是指修改数据库中已有数据记录的值。更新操作可以通过使用UPDATE语句来实现,根据指定的条件更新表中的数据。更新操作常用于修改用户信息、更新订单状态等。
  4. 数据的删除:数据的删除是指从数据库中删除指定的数据记录。删除操作可以通过使用DELETE语句来实现,根据指定的条件删除表中的数据。删除操作常用于删除不需要的数据或错误数据。

数据库的更改具有以下优势:

  1. 数据一致性:通过数据库的更改操作,可以确保数据的一致性。数据库管理系统提供了事务机制,可以保证一系列的更改操作要么全部执行成功,要么全部回滚,从而保持数据的一致性。
  2. 数据安全性:数据库的更改操作可以通过权限控制来限制用户对数据的访问和修改。只有具有相应权限的用户才能进行数据库的更改操作,从而保证数据的安全性。
  3. 数据持久化:数据库的更改操作可以将数据持久化存储在磁盘中,即使在系统故障或断电情况下,数据也能够得到保护和恢复。

数据库的更改在各个领域都有广泛的应用场景,例如:

  1. 电子商务:数据库的更改操作用于管理商品信息、订单信息、用户信息等。
  2. 社交网络:数据库的更改操作用于管理用户关系、消息记录、动态更新等。
  3. 物流管理:数据库的更改操作用于管理货物信息、仓库信息、运输信息等。
  4. 在线教育:数据库的更改操作用于管理课程信息、学生信息、成绩记录等。

腾讯云提供了多个与数据库相关的产品和服务,包括:

  1. 云数据库MySQL:提供高性能、可扩展的MySQL数据库服务,适用于各种规模的应用。
  2. 云数据库MongoDB:提供高性能、可扩展的MongoDB数据库服务,适用于大数据存储和分析场景。
  3. 云数据库Redis:提供高性能、高可用的Redis数据库服务,适用于缓存、队列等场景。
  4. 云数据库SQL Server:提供稳定可靠的SQL Server数据库服务,适用于企业级应用。

更多关于腾讯云数据库产品的详细介绍和使用指南,可以访问腾讯云官方网站:腾讯云数据库

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

【GIT版本控制】--提交更改

一、添加文件到暂存区 在GIT中,要提交更改,首先需要将文件添加到暂存区(Staging Area)。这是一个用于存放将要提交更改临时区域。...二、进行提交 在GIT中,要提交更改,可以按照以下步骤进行提交: 打开终端或命令提示符,并导航到包含你GIT仓库项目目录。 检查当前仓库状态,以确保你要提交更改已经添加到暂存区。...如果你更改已经在暂存区中,可以使用 git commit 命令来创建一个新提交并将更改保存到版本历史中。...现在,你已经成功进行了提交,你更改已保存到GIT仓库版本历史中。你可以继续进行更多提交来跟踪项目的演变。提交是GIT版本控制核心操作之一,它允许你记录项目的每个版本和更改。...这包括在终端中检查仓库状态,使用git commit命令创建一个新提交并将更改保存到版本历史中步骤。提交消息是用来简要描述提交目的。 第三部分讲解了如何查看GIT仓库提交历史。

23730

Gitlab更改项目间fork提交关系

一.前情提要 1.dzsw/cgd_xx项目,通过fork按钮在dzsw_dev组下面同步了一个项目 2.但是现在dzsw/cgd_xx项目因为没法提交合并请求,一点击请求就显示502。...查看日志显示如下,搜索百度都是将timeout超时时间放大,但这里可能是因为没有从数据库查看对应信息出错,不管多大都会卡主,而且调大会导致服务器CPU和内存直线增高,用于数据库查询。...后面想到其实可以更改fork依赖关系,这个东西应该会在数据库存放。 二.实际操作 1..先将dzsw/cgd_portal项目导出一份,项目-》设置-》常规-》倒数第二个导出。...setting-》Advanced settings-》Remove fork relationship 3.检查新项目是否和老一样,比如分支,代码等等,确保没问题后,将原项目备份成别的名字,记得更改设置里项目地址...4.登陆到gitlab所在机器,在数据库里执行如下,这个命令是psql数据库非交互命令,sql语句就是查询项目表,查看他id号。

1.4K10
  • OrientDB提交数据库

    Rollback是指将数据库状态恢复到打开事务点,以下语句是Commit database命令基本语法。 COMMIT 注意:只有在连接到特定数据库和开始事务之后,才能使用此命令。...例 在这个例子中,我们将使用我们在上一章中创建名为“demo”数据库。 我们将看到提交事务操作,并使用事务存储记录。 首先,使用以下BEGIN命令启动事务。...orientdb {db = demo}> BEGIN 然后,使用以下命令将记录插入到值为id = 12和name = satish.Pemployee表中。...orientdb> INSERT INTO employee (id, name) VALUES (12, 'satish.P') 您可以使用下面的命令来提交事务。...orientdb> commit 如果此事务成功提交,您将获得以下输出。 Transaction 2 has been committed in 4ms

    53220

    审计存储在MySQL 8.0中分类数据更改

    在之前博客中,我讨论了如何审计分类数据查询。本篇将介绍如何审计机密数据所做数据更改。...敏感数据可能被标记为– 高度敏感 最高机密 分类 受限制 需要清除 高度机密 受保护 合规要求通常会要求以某种方式对数据进行分类或标记,并审计该数据上数据库事件。...但是在这种情况下,您将审计所有的更改。如果您只想审计敏感数据是否已更改,下面是您可以执行一种方法。 一个解决方法 本示例使用MySQL触发器来审计数据更改。...在这种情况下,FOR将具有要更改其级别数据名称,而ACTION将是在更新(之前和之后),插入或删除时使用名称。...请记住,只有“ H” sec_level列进行更改时,触发器才会审计。

    4.6K10

    由表单提交引伸JS设计模式思考

    https://blog.csdn.net/j_bleach/article/details/72860322 表单提交 ?...表单提交是业务当中在普通不过场景了,以QQ登陆页面为例,在注册一个qq账号的话,如果不能填写必填字段,是不会发起http请求,于是乎我们有了这样一段JS代码。...,我们很容易将验证这段代码抽离出去,进步地方是,在修改验证函数时,不会直接修改login,但这样依旧没有改掉第一版诟病,login函数当中依旧引入了验证函数,本质上是没有变化,验证与发送http...alert(`${a.key}不能为空`) return false; } } return true; } JS...设计模式思考 通过这次表达提交,总结一下,在JS设计当中,需要遵循几个原则。

    97650

    事务隔离与更改数据库关系

    10)事务隔离与更改数据库关系: 马克-to-win:当 然,为了保持数据一致性和数据库正确性,涉及到同时改变数据库(update,insert,delete)时,不管任何隔离级别,事务一定是序列...执行。...先执行事务挡住(block)后执行事务正好要改变数据库那句话(换句话说,在那句话后面的事务就卡在那了)。后执行事务需要获得相关 行“行排他锁”才能改数据。...先执行,一定是事务完成才释放“行排他锁”。注意不止是那句更新完成就释放“行排他锁”。马克-to-win:先执行事务一完成,后面的事务 立刻继续。注意二者都commit后,对数据库改变是叠加。...只要commit,改变就不会白做,保证了数据库正确性。

    61810

    更改 WordPress 数据库表名前缀

    但是很多空间商,尤其是老外虚拟主机商 允许建立多个数据库,这样为了便于管理,很多人在安装多个WordPress 程序时候选择多个数据库而不是修改表名前缀,当然这样方式也是被提倡。...如若碰到多个数据库合为单个数据库时候,头疼事情就来了,这种情况往往在从国外往国内搬时候,国内空间商不知道为何如此吝啬 table_prefix = ‘wp_’; 改为 既然碰到这种情况,自然修改表名了...,或者新建一个WordPress 用WordPress eXtended RSS导入(manage - export),不过这不是这里要讨论更改 WordPress 数据库表名前缀步骤: 禁用所有插件...,然后通过 phpmyadmin 备份你 WordPress 数据库。...用文本编辑器打开你备份数据库文件(*.sql),查找“wp_”,并用你准备用表明比如“Bssn_”替换。 使用 phpmyadmin 将你当前数据库 WordPress 表删除。

    1.5K10

    数据库PostrageSQL-异步提交

    异步提交 异步提交是一个允许事务能更快完成选项,代价是在数据库崩溃时最近事务会丢失。在很多应用中这是一个可接受交换。...使用异步提交带来风险是数据丢失,而不是数据损坏。如果数据库可能崩溃,它会通过重放WAL到被刷写最后一个记录来进行恢复。...特定实用命令,如DROP TABLE,被强制按照同步提交而不考虑synchronous_commit设定。这是为了确保服务器文件系统和数据库逻辑状态之间一致性。...支持两阶段提交命令页总是同步提交,如PREPARE TRANSACTION。 如果数据库在异步提交和事务WAL记录写入之间风险窗口期间崩溃,在该事务期间所作修改将丢失。...它禁用了PostgreSQL中所有尝试同步写入到数据库不同部分逻辑,并且因此一次系统崩溃(即,一个硬件或操作系统崩溃,不是PostgreSQL本身失败)可能造成数据库状态任意损坏。

    97910

    IDEA中Git常规操作(合并,提交,新建分支,更新)

    提交到远程仓库 场景四:小张从远程仓库获取小袁提交 场景五:小袁接受了一个新功能任务,创建了一个分支并在分支上开发 场景六:小袁把分支提交到远程Git仓库 场景七:小张获取小袁提交分支 场景八:...下图是Git与提交有关三个命令对应操作,Add命令是把文件从IDE工作目录添加到本地仓库stage区,Commit命令把stage区暂存文件提交到当前分支仓库,并清空stage区。...Push命令把本地仓库提交同步到远程仓库。 ? IDEA中操作做了一定简化,Commit和Push可以在一步中完成。 具体操作,在项目上点击右键,选择Git菜单 ? ? ?...场景三:小袁修改了部分源码,提交到远程仓库 这个操作和首次提交流程基本一致,分别是 Add -> Commit -> Push。...注意,这里创建分支仅仅在本地仓库,如果想让组长小张获取到这个分支,还需要提交到远程仓库。 场景六:小袁把分支提交到远程Git仓库 切换到新建分支,使用Push功能 ? ?

    4.1K31

    提交storm项目jar包引发jar原理探索

    序:在开发storm项目时,提交项目jar包当把依赖第三方jar包都打进去提交storm集群启动时报了发现多个同名文件错误由此开始了一段jar包深刻理解之路。.../defaults.yaml] 这里说明stom集群环境中有stormjar包,我们提交jar包里面也包含stormjar包,在读取配置文件时,发现有一样文件冲突了导致启动错误。...但是把它提交到storm集群中,它是会运行,这是因为stom集群Class-Path路径有jdk和stormjar包了(我们使用java -jar命令就是jdk什么。)。...但是我们提交该jar包到storm集群中,报了如下错误: java.lang.RuntimeException: Found multiple defaults.yaml resources..../defaults.yaml] 这里说明stom集群环境中有stormjar包,我们提交jar包里面也包含stormjar包,在读取配置文件时,发现有一样文件冲突了导致启动错误。

    86210

    事务提交之后再执行某些操作 → 引发 TransactionSynchronizationManager 探究

    那么我们只需要验证:此时事务是否已经提交   问题又来了,如何验证事务已经提交了呢?   ...很简单,我们直接去数据库查对应记录,是不是修改之后数据,如果是,那就说明事务已经提交,否则说明事务没提交,能理解吧?   ...我们以修改 张三 密码为例, bebug 未开始,此时 张三 密码是 zhangsan1   我们把 张三 密码改成 zhangsan2   开始 bebug   此时,消息还未发送,我们去数据库查下...是不是很优雅实现了最初重点:把消息发送从事务中拎出来就好了,也就是等事务提交后,再发消息 TransactionSynchronizationManager   从字面意思来看,就是一个事务同步管理器...,开发者可以自定义实现 TransactionSynchronization 接口或继承 TransactionSynchronizationAdapter   从而在事务不同阶段(如提交前、提交

    20400
    领券